    Australia's Fibre To The Node network – delayed, surprise surprise.

    image

    The Rudd Government’s $8bn fibre network is being delayed for at least a few months. The provider is still yet to be selected. The FTTN network aims to give broadband of at least 8Mbps to 98% of Australians.

    It sounds like a great step foward for Australia in this digital age, but action is needed not delay after delay. The network is already expected to take 5 years to complete, by that time the international speeds for broadband, may well surpass the projected speeds for this project.
